Latest Patents
Donovan holds one patent titled "Systems and methods for constructing images." This patent outlines techniques and systems for creating three-dimensional representations of anatomical structures from a series of images. The invention involves generating interpolated images between actual images and defining voxels based on pixel values from both actual and interpolated images. As a result, a comprehensive three-dimensional representation of the structure can be constructed using these voxels, which could significantly enhance visual understanding in medical applications.
